Reese goose-box bed clearance

Currently have standard pinbox and Ford puck system hitch and considering switching to a Reese goosebox and ball in the bed. My concern is the bed rail clearance I have heard is a concern, any experience with similar 5th wheel and truck? The last trip seemed very rough and the roads aren't getting better.

I switched from a PullRite 2600 single point hitch to the Reese Goosebox with no change in bed clearance, I think I'm at about 6 1/2". No issues. Same RAM truck with both hitches. My 5th is perfectly level according to my Starrett 98 machinery level.
You can buy different size (height) gooseneck balls.
